
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ue for Q4 2019 was $5.2 million, an increase from $4.6 million in Q3 2019 but a decrease from $5.9 million in Q4 2018. For the full year 2019, revenue was $19.8 million compared to $23.3 million in 2018 [25] - Gross margin for Q4 2019 was 43%, lower than typical due to revenue mix and equipment write-off. The gross margin for 2019 was 62%, down from 65% in 2018 [28] - Net loss attributable to common shareholders for Q4 2019 was $1.3 million or $0.45 per share, compared to net income of $44,000 or $0.02 per share in Q4 2018. For 2019, the net loss was $2.1 million or $0.72 per share, compared to a loss of $275,000 or $0.10 per share in 2018 [31]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The Buzztime Basic offering has been launched, with approximately 165 sites currently using it. The product has a lower revenue per venue but is expected to scale due to its low cash requirement and high gross margin [10][11] - Buzztime Elite ended 2019 with 1,440 sites, including approximately 100 franchise Buffalo Wild Wings venues. The company has seen migration of players from locations that no longer offer Buzztime to new venues [12][13] - Hardware revenue increased in Q4 2019 due to the delivery of tablets to a jail partner, with expectations to continue deliveries throughout 2020 [26]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company is facing strong headwinds in the restaurant and bar industry due to the COVID-19 pandemic, which has created uncertainty in growth and site count [11] - The advertising revenue from the programmatic ad exchange grew over 50% sequentially from Q3 to Q4 2019, reaching $78,000, with expectations for further growth in Q1 2020 [17][18]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on growing its digital entertainment and hardware businesses efficiently, with a roadmap for scalable growth that includes mobile-based solutions and programmatic advertising [7][8] - A mid-range hybrid solution is being developed to offer a cost-effective upgrade to the Buzztime Basic offering, targeting a broader market [14] - The company is exploring partnerships and customizable channels to expand its audience and enhance its marketing capabilities [15][16]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ledges the rapid imp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on the restaurant and bar industry and is monitoring government restrictions to mitigate effects on the business [11] - The company is seeking creative financing solutions to address liquidity constraints and is focused on reducing overhead costs, including staff reductions [22][23][34] Other Important Information - The company has a healthy hardware pipeline valued at over $30 million, indicating optimism for future revenue growth despite potential lumpiness in orders [20] - Cash, cash equivalents, and restricted cash were $3.4 million at the end of 2019, an increase from $2.8 million at the end of 2018 [35] Q&A Session Summary Question: What are the expectations for advertising revenue growth? - Management indicated that advertising revenue is on track to more than double sequentially from Q4 2019, despite having 40% fewer sites at the beginning of Q1 2020 [17] Question: How is the company addressing liquidity constraints? - The company is exploring financing opportunities and has signed an amendment to its loan agreement to manage increased debt service obligations [22][34] Question: What is the strategy for the hardware business moving forward? - The company plans to continue expanding its hardware business and is optimistic about the market opportunity, despite potential supply chain disruptions due to COVID-19 [19][21]
